Can i bring cooked food on contianer hand carry on continental domestic flight from florida to new orleans

Sure, as long as it isn't a liquid or gel. So no soup or stuff with sauce, but something roasted, baked or fried should be fine. I often bring sandwiches, and lately even roasted chicken and veggies. Never had a problem. Mildly amusing, distantly relevant story: One time, coming back from the Philippines, my mother hand-carried a box of a cooked local delicacy. At US Customs they had no problem letting her bring it in, but the customs agent -- whose family was also from the Philippines -- asked my mom if she could have one! Of course, being Filipina, my mom always had plenty of food to share.... Point is, I think your biggest problem is envy from your fellow travelers. =)
